About
Testimonial
Application Process
Events
Vendor Payment Center
0 items
About
Testimonial
Application Process
Events
Vendor Payment Center
0 items
Vendor Application
About
Testimonial
Application Process
Events
Vendor Payment Center
0 items
About
Testimonial
Application Process
Events
Vendor Payment Center
0 items
Facebook
Instagram
Natures Tech Inc.
8006860596
customerservice@naturestechusa.com
Visit Our Website